She Blew Through $75m in Advertising and Went Down in the Polls

Clinton spent $257m on her campaign to Trump’s $87m so far this election cycle.  In June it was reported that Clinton spent $23m on ads in swing states to Trump’s $0.  By mid-August Clinton had spent more than $75 million on advertising in 10 swing states to Trump’s $0.  Trump has since invested $5 million in swing state advertising.

No One is Showing Up at Her Events

Hillary Clinton has only one Clinton campaign event scheduled (on Thursday in Las Vegas) in the foreseeable future. No other campaign rallies are currently scheduled! Trump on the other hand continues to materially outpace Hillary Clinton in rallies and in attendance at campaign events.  Through the first three weeks of August Trump has more than doubled the number of events that Clinton has. Month to date through Sunday August 21st Trump has held 24 campaign events to Clinton’s 10.  He also has events scheduled daily through Thursday, August 25th.  (Note that this list only includes individual campaign speaking engagements and not fundraisers or visits with government and corporate leaders which Trump appears to be outpacing Clinton as well.)

Due in part to the number of events held, Trump continues to significantly outpace the number of event goers that Clinton has month to date. Trump has accumulated more than 135,000 people at his rallies while Clinton has accumulated only a little more than 10,000. As a result Trump has 13 times more attendees at his events than does Hillary.

She is Getting Destroyed on Social Media

Trump is crushing Clinton in basically every conceivable numerical measure on social media.  He has double the Facebook ‘likes’ (10m to 5m), a 5 to 4 ratio (11m to 8m) in Twitter followers,  averages 30,000 livestream viewers on YouTube to Hillary’s 500, and ‘Hillary for Prison’ has more Reddit subscribers (55,000) than Hillary subscribers (24,000) while Trump has nearly 200,000 Reddit subscribers.
